THERMAL RADIATION PHENOMENA. VOLUME II. THE EQUILIBRIUM RADIATIVE PROPERTIES OF AIR - THEORY

Abstract

Contents: Theory of radiation in hot gases (elementary radiative transfer, theory of radiation, theory of molecular absorption); Spectral and mean absorption coefficients of heated air (historical review: research on hot gas absorption coefficients since 1900, general features of air absorption coefficients, molecular absorption coefficients, atomic absorption coefficients) ; Spectroscopic properties of six important band systems which contribute to the opacity of heated air.
